How to Compare Retirement Insurance with Confidence

Retirement insurance should support your life now, not add unnecessary cost or complexity. The first step is to review what protection you already have, then compare how each policy handles age, coverage limits, and monthly premiums.

For many retirees, the right choice depends on balancing everyday budget concerns with the type of support that matters most. Some plans focus on basic protection, while others offer broader coverage but may cost more over time.

It also helps to check whether the policy terms are easy to follow. Clear renewal conditions, benefit details, and exclusions can make a major difference when you want coverage that feels practical and manageable.
